WebTeething does not cause colds, rashes, diarrhea, or fever. But it can make a baby uncomfortable. Most studies show that teething may cause some symptoms, such as making babies fussier, but doesn’t cause rashes or fever.
WebTeething can be painful, but it doesn’t usually make babies sick. Call your doctor if your baby has diarrhea , vomiting , rashes on the body, a higher fever , or cough and congestion. The short answer is this: teething does not cause a true fever but may occasionally lead to a slightly elevated temperature, sometimes called a low-grade fever.
